原文:JavaServlet实现下载功能

我们在项目中经常会用到下载功能,所以今天我们先说下下载功能实现的思路,然后通过一个案例代码来具体体现。 .下载的思路: 首先要获取我们要操作的文件对象的路径 然后使用获取的文件对象路径构建一个文件操作流对象 设置好相关的http响应的头,告诉浏览器怎么来操作我们写回的数据,是下载 打开等等。 通过response获取字节流,并结合我们的文件流进行读取和写出操作 关闭相关的流资源 .下载具体ser ...

2017-07-06 19:26 0 2646 推荐指数:

查看详情

JS实现下载功能

如果不是特别大的文件,比如图片,可以直接通过JS实现下载。 ...

Mon Jun 24 18:37:00 CST 2019 1 2318
php实现下载功能

<?php header("Content-type:text/html;charset=utf-8"); $file_name="1.text"; //解决中文不能显示出来的问题 $file_ ...

Tue Jun 25 00:38:00 CST 2019 0 814
ajax实现下载功能

ajax实现下载功能 适用场景:由于点击按钮下载excel响应时间过长,此时间段加入加载样式(灰色层、加载动画);       浏览器弹出下载框后,上面的加载样式去掉。   方 法 :使用jquery.fileDownload.js插件导出excel;       弹出框 ...

Wed Feb 22 01:01:00 CST 2017 0 2736
js实现下载功能(一、iframe方式)

1.window.frames方式 frames[]是窗口中所有命名的框架组成的数组。这个数组的每个元素都是一个Window对象,对应于窗口中的一个框架。 <iframe name=' ...

Wed Sep 30 18:44:00 CST 2020 0 613
java实现下载excel功能

1,获取服务器现有excel文件 2,将步骤1返回的数据转换成excel所需要的字符串格式 3,执行下载功能 ps:excel文件的xls格式默认纯数字的数据将不能正常显示,所以根据实际经验下载excel文件时设置成csv体验会更好一点 步骤 ...

Thu Jan 18 17:47:00 CST 2018 0 3954
Flask-实现下载功能

1. 接口返回真实的文件 这种情况比较简单, flask里带有此类api, 可以用send_from_directory和send_file. 核心代码如下: 后边那个as_attachme ...

Mon Sep 02 23:08:00 CST 2019 0 972
js a 标签 通过download 实现下载功能

download 属性规定被下载的超链接目标。 在 <a> 标签中必须设置 href 属性。 该属性也可以设置一个值来规定下载文件的名称。所允许的值没有限制,浏览器将自动检测正确的文件扩展名并添加到文件 (.img, .pdf, .txt, .html ...

Tue Oct 22 17:51:00 CST 2019 0 1775
【vue】---- 前端实现下载Excel功能

1、实现思路: html5 中,在 a 标签上添加 download 属性可以实现文件下载。 <a download="文件名" href="文件下载接口地址"></a> 2、在这次项目中,点击非a标签按钮下载文件,通过创建a标签来实现 ...

Thu Jul 02 08:16:00 CST 2020 0 3669
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M